Revolutionizing E-Commerce with Neural Radiance Fields: The Future of Real-Time 3D Rendering
The e-commerce landscape has undergone a significant transformation in recent years, driven by the need for immersive and interactive shopping experiences. Gone are the days of static 2D images; today’s customers expect to be able to explore products as if they were physically present. This shift towards enhanced customer engagement has led to the emergence of innovative technologies like Neural Radiance Fields (NeRFs), which promise to revolutionize real-time 3D rendering in e-commerce platforms.
At the core of NeRFs are volumetric rendering and neural network optimization, combining multilayer perceptrons (MLPs) to calculate density and color for every point in a 3D model. This enables the creation of highly realistic and interactive 3D models that can be used to visualize products from various angles, customize features, and even simulate lighting effects.
NeRF-based rendering has numerous applications in e-commerce, including product visualization, customer engagement, and scalability. By enabling businesses to create high-quality 3D models at scale with just a few images, NeRFs automate much of the process, saving time and money while maintaining excellent visual quality. This is particularly beneficial for large platforms managing vast product catalogs.
To integrate NeRF-based rendering into e-commerce, businesses must carefully prepare by investing in high-performance GPUs or leveraging cloud computing resources. Software tools like NVIDIA Instant NeRF and PyTorch3D simplify the training and deployment of NeRF models, making adoption easier for smaller businesses. Cost is also a crucial factor; while initial investments may be significant, the long-term benefits often outweigh the expense.
Despite its promise, NeRF-based rendering faces challenges, including latency and accessibility concerns. However, ongoing trends offer solutions, such as automated AI tools to simplify model creation and lightweight implementations that enable high-quality 3D rendering on mobile devices. Sustainability is also gaining attention as the energy demands of large-scale computing become more concerning.
